I finally took the first photos of my monopole billboards under construction today. Basically, this project began when I decided I'd be modeling a portion of Interstate 30 in Fort Worth as it passes over the trackage I'm modeling. There are billboards located all along I30, so I figured a pair, one on each side of the highway, would help create the desired effect of an urban, rush-hour type highway. Since I couldn't find any billboards on the market that resemble anything built during my lifetime, I decided to scratchbuild.

The first step was to make the drawings. I did some research and came up with a couple common sizes of billboards, the largest of which measures 14 ft. x 48 ft. There's a billboard right near my office, so I took a couple photos and imported them into AutoCAD:

I drew a rectangle measuring 14 ft. x 48 ft. and scaled the photo to fit. I took the second photo as straight on as possible to make scaling it easier. Here's a photo of the resulting drawings:

I don't have any photos of the billboard face under construction, but suffice it to say I built two faces, strip by strip (very tedious!). Once they were mounted to the pole, I began building the walkways from a fine etched brass sheet and strip styrene epoxied to the edges of the brass:

original.gif



I primed what had been assembled so far and began adding the walkways. That is the current state of the project.

No, I haven't used Mark 4, but I did contact them about doing some rapid prototyping. It turns out I'd need to have my drawings "converted" or redrawn in Inventor or some other native 3D format, so there's really an extra step (and charge) in there from what I expected, since I don't own or know how to operate Inventor. And, it's important to note that the cost of the item you want is directly proportional to its volume. In other words, an N scale boxcar body master might cost you say $100. The same thing in HO scale would cost about $400 because it's volumetrically larger. Make sense?

I have also spoken with Jim King (SMMW) about the same subject, but it was in reference to a kit I'd like to produce. In that case, the conversation was more of a technical nature and I didn't get into price.

Interesting you mention "needing guys like me" for this sort of work. I've done this in the past for a couple companies. If there's anything I can suggest when trying to commission technical drawings, get every conceivable measurement, photo angle, and make every sketch you can. The draftsman doesn't want to assume anything, and in many cases, just doesn't have the familiarity with the subject matter to make those assumptions. Also, triple his estimate - we're good at quantifying and measuring things, not prognosticating! ;)

Latest Progress Photos

These aren't the greatest photos, but they're a little better than the last batch. At least the sunlight makes it look a little less pasty. Anyway, I tried to shoot the safety cage and walkway, but I think I need Bob Boudreau's camera to do it!

The safety cage "hoops" are from Tichy, the vertical railings and ladder uprights are strip styrene and the ladder rungs are stretched sprue. I never would have scratchbuilt a ladder, but I ran out of the Tichy ladder stock after using it all on the ladder that goes down the front of the billboard. You can also see where some of the epoxy I used to fasten the etched metal down to the walkway frames got into the "see-through" area. I'll have to clean that out because it's pretty distracting.
